Postby 12345 » Mon Dec 11, 2006 9:13 pm

It's not really anything new exactly. It's on the current Sloth Housing page:

http://www.slothmud.org/index.php?name=PagEd&page_id=43

The exact entry you're looking for is:

[quote:2o3puwnp]3M Special trigtraps (anyone can purchase)[/quote:2o3puwnp]

Basically, we bought a trap in. We learned about it from our good friend Derro the pthief, who had bought one so that he didn't need to worry about carrying a vault key on Hellmaster and such.

The problem with them is... you don't strictly need a key. So, if you get pissed off and have a lot of time on your hands... its possible to guess them. Like we did to Derro :P

The easier way is to have someone just tell you the password... and then when it becomes public you end up with all kinds of craziness like happened in the DS vault.

Postby *Splork* » Tue Dec 12, 2006 2:37 am

I have no problem with tt's used to enter vaults but we need a way to prevent these spaces from becoming public regen areas.


Here is the solution I am leaning towards. There can be no doors or tt's from these regen rooms to vault spaces.

This way, you open up your vault to everyone, you also open it up to pthieves who can hack your vaults.
